The Royal Fleet Auxiliary oiler Ruthenia anchored at Weihaiwei.
A slightly distant port bow view of the Royal Fleet Auxiliary oiler Ruthenia (1900) anchored at Weihaiwei. She is dressed overall, her accommodation ladder is deployed amidships and she is lightly laden. A copy negative of a photographic print.
